coloque o seguinte código em:
/etc/init.d/rc.local
:
/home/pi/cgminer-4.5.0/cgminer -o http://xxxxxxxxxxx -u xxxxxxxx -p xxxxxxxxxx
Eu tenho os seguintes comandos que eu quero executar quando o raspberry pi é iniciado, é para o meu minador de bitcoins começar:
cd /home/pi/cgminer-4.5.0
sudo ./cgminer -o http://xxxxxxxxxxx -u xxxxxxxx -p xxxxxxxxxx
Como posso fazer isso? Como eu tenho atualmente configurá-lo usando nohup mas isso só autostarts quando eu ssh no pi e pára de funcionar quando eu fechar a conexão. Eu quero que este código seja executado automaticamente na inicialização e continue correndo constantemente. Eu estou correndo Raspbian.
nohup
deve estar certo para mantê-lo funcionando após a desconexão. Talvez o seu problema esteja em outro lugar.
Se você quiser executar algo na inicialização, poderá usar a tag @reboot
em uma entrada crontab
.
sudo crontab -e
Em seguida, adicione a linha
@reboot /full/path/to/script.sh
Isso é executado como usuário root. By the way, por que root
? E por que o meu em um raspi?
Tags startup raspberry-pi